Transaction 381e6ce1c75787fa6167a58f8f3aee7f1964f86365e392fd54179c901f525cca
1 Input
1 Output
-
381e6ce1c75787fa6167a58f8f3aee7f1964f86365e392fd54179c901f525cca:0
- value
- 72507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f007d607ee072f419914d4653a041d69767025c OP_EQUAL
- address
- 37S95f6vjrxo7hhNZQ1HQbyGB26W4GST9c